在大数据中,针对称加密与非对称加密的优缺点解析
47
0
0
0
在当今大数据时代,数据安全问题愈显重要。在这个背景下,加密技术成为了保护数据隐私的关键手段。那么,在大数据应用场景中,针对称加密与非对称加密的优缺点究竟是什么呢?
称加密的优缺点
称加密,又称对称加密,它的特点是加密和解密使用相同的密钥。先说优点:
- 速度快:由于对称加密算法的计算复杂度一般较低,因此在处理大数据时能够快速完成加密及解密的过程。
- 资源消耗少:通常对称加密所需的计算资源远低于非对称加密,更适合资源受限的环境。
称加密也有其局限性:
- 密钥管理困难:当数据传输涉及多个用户时,如何安全地共享密钥成为一大挑战。如果密钥被窃取,所有使用该密钥加密的数据都可能被泄露。
- 不具备身份认证:对于对称加密,接收者无法确认发送者的身份,容易出现中间人攻击的风险。
非对称加密的优缺点
非对称加密,又称公钥加密,使用一对密钥:公钥和私钥。其主要优点包括:
- 安全性高:通过公钥进行加密,只能通过对应的私钥进行解密,即使公钥被公开,数据也不会被泄露。
- 身份认证:接收者可以通过私钥生成数字签名,从而验证发送者的身份,有效防止了伪造数据的行为。
而非对称加密同样存在一些缺陷:
- 速度慢:由于非对称加密的算法复杂,处理数据的效率较低。在对大规模数据的加密时不如对称加密高效。
- 资源消耗高:相较于对称加密,非对称加密需要更多的计算资源,对于大数据处理时可能成为瓶颈。
实际应用中的选择
在大数据背景下,选择何种加密方式往往依赖于具体应用场景。如果应用对加密速度和资源消耗有较高要求,同时数据安全性需求不高,称加密无疑是较优选择;而在需要确保身份认证及数据高度安全的场景,非对称加密更为合适。
在大多数情况下,可以考虑结合使用两者:先利用非对称加密进行密钥交换,再用生成的对称密钥进行数据加密。这样既能够兼顾安全性,也能提升性能。